How to make Green Bean and Lotus Seed Dessert
-
Soak lotus seeds and green beans
First, soak the green beans and lotus seeds in water for at least 4 hours. If you don’t have much time, you can also soak them in warm water for 1 hour.
After the green beans and lotus seeds have expanded, rinse them and let them drain.
-
Green bean and lotus seed stew
Put the green beans in a pot and add water until it reaches the level of the beans, then place the pot on the stove and cook until the beans are soft.
Add lotus seeds to another pot and add water, making sure to add a little more water for the lotus seeds, and also boil this mixture on the stove.
When the pot with green beans and lotus seeds is boiling, reduce the heat and continue to cook until the green beans and lotus seeds are soft. Make sure to skim off any foam if there is any.
Cook the green beans for about 10 – 15 minutes until they are done. At this point, when you see the green beans are just cooked, turn off the heat and drain any excess water.
After draining all the water, let the green beans sit in the pot for another 5 minutes to ensure they are fully cooked.
For the lotus seeds, do the same as for the green beans.
Tip:- When cooking, add a little salt to enhance the flavor of the green beans and lotus seeds.
- To cook the green beans faster, soak them thoroughly beforehand.
- If you prefer the green beans to bloom fully, cook them for a few more minutes.
-
Cooking the dessert
For the tapioca starch, you add 2 tablespoons of water and stir well until completely dissolved.
Next, you pour about 800ml of water into a pot, bring it to a boil, and then add 200g of granulated sugar and cook until the sugar dissolves.
Once the sugar has completely dissolved, you add the prepared tapioca starch water and stir until it reaches your desired thickness. When the tapioca starch is fully cooked and the water becomes thick, you add the cooked mung beans and stir well.
Then, add all the lotus seeds and stir continuously until it boils again. When the dessert pot has boiled again, you turn off the heat and add 2 drops of vanilla essence, stirring well.
Tip:- You can adjust the amount of sugar for the dessert to suit your taste.
- To make the dessert smooth, when adding the tapioca starch, remember to stir in one fixed direction.
-
Completion
Wait until the dessert cools, then serve it in bowls, pour coconut milk on top, and sprinkle some dried coconut over it to enjoy.
-
Final Product
The dessert, when cooled, has a thick consistency, with the green beans and lotus seeds cooked soft and not mushy.
When eaten, the dessert has a mild sweetness, fragrant with the scent of vanilla and the characteristic aroma of green beans and lotus seeds, along with the creamy taste of coconut milk and the crunchiness of shredded coconut, which is very enjoyable to chew.
All the flavors blend together to create a delicious and highly nutritious dessert.

How to make green bean lotus seed dessert with red apples
-
Prepare the main ingredients
After purchasing, wash the green beans thoroughly. Then soak them in water for 5 – 6 hours to soften the beans.
Tip: If you don’t have much time, you can soak the beans in warm water for about 1 hour to help soften them, making them tastier when cooked.Fresh lotus seeds should be washed, then boiled to remove some of the sap and reduce the bitterness. Boil until the water is boiling, then remove the lotus seeds and rinse with clean water. This will help the lotus seeds to be white, delicious, and not fall apart.
Soak the red apples in warm water for 10 – 15 minutes, then remove and drain. For chia seeds, soak them in cold water for 15 minutes, occasionally stirring gently to ensure even swelling.
-
Sauté green beans and lotus seeds with sugar, simmer until soft
You add the prepared lotus seeds and green beans into the pot, add 3 tablespoons of white sugar. Start sautéing for 5 minutes over medium heat, until the sugar is completely dissolved.
Next, add 1.5 liters of water, wait about 5 – 10 minutes for the water to boil. Then, actively skim off the foam so that the sweet soup remains clear and does not become cloudy.
Next, add 200g of palm sugar for a mild sweetness and an appealing color. Then continue to simmer over medium heat for 15 – 20 minutes.
Tip: If you do not use palm sugar, you can use white sugar, rock sugar, or brown sugar instead. -
Cook the dessert
After simmering the mung beans and lotus seeds, add red apples and pandan leaves and continue to cook for another 10 minutes until the ingredients are soft. Next, add the chia seeds, stirring well for 2 minutes.
-
Complete
Finally, mix 60ml of water with 1 tablespoon of tapioca starch, whisking continuously until the starch is completely dissolved. Then, slowly pour the tapioca mixture into the pot of dessert, stirring well to thicken the dessert, cover, and cook for an additional minute.
-
Final product
After the dessert is cooked, scoop it into a bowl or a cup. First, scoop out the lotus seeds and mung beans, then add the red apples, and garnish with a little shredded coconut to make the dish more visually appealing.
The mung bean and lotus seed dessert with red apples and chia seeds has a very beautiful color, an enticing aroma, and a pleasantly sweet taste. The dessert can be eaten hot or allowed to cool and served with ice, which also provides a wonderful flavor.
How to choose good lotus seeds
- When buying fresh lotus seeds, you should choose those still on the lotus pod that have just been harvested. When selecting unpeeled lotus seeds, choose those with an off-white or deep yellow color, with a smooth, taut outer shell that is not cracked or mushy.
- When choosing dried lotus seeds, you should select those that have had the germ removed, are opaque white, small and uniform because when eaten, they have a very fragrant and rich flavor, containing high nutritional content. Avoid choosing seeds that are damaged by pests, chipped, or have a musty smell due to being stored for too long.
How to choose good green beans for making sweet soup
- To save time in preparation, you should choose those that have been peeled, with a beautiful yellow color, the halves of the beans are firm, without pests, and have the characteristic aroma of green beans.
- If you buy whole green beans, you should choose those that are plump, evenly sized, and free from pests or being shriveled.
